Electronic Medical Records

Electronic Medical Records (EMRs) have revolutionized the way healthcare information is stored, accessed, and managed. These digital versions of patients' paper charts contain comprehensive medical histories, diagnoses, medications, treatment plans, immunization dates, allergies, radiology images, and laboratory test results.

Centralized Record Keeping

EMR systems allow individuals to store all their medical information in one centralized location. This includes medical history, diagnoses, medications, lab results, and more. Having all this information readily accessible can be invaluable during medical appointments, emergencies, or when seeking treatment from different healthcare providers.

Efficiency and Accuracy

Electronic records are easier to update, organize, and search compared to traditional paper records. This can improve the efficiency of healthcare visits by providing quick access to relevant medical information. Additionally, electronic records reduce the risk of errors associated with handwritten notes or misfiled documents.

Accessibility

With a personal EMR accessible via the web, individuals can access their medical records from anywhere with an internet connection. This accessibility is particularly useful for frequent travelers, individuals living in remote areas, or those seeking medical care while away from home.

Empowerment and Engagement

By giving individuals more control over their health information, personal EMR systems empower patients to take an active role in managing their healthcare. Patients can track their progress over time, set health goals, and make more informed decisions about their care.

Long-Term Health Monitoring

Personal EMR systems enable individuals to track their health over the long term, allowing for early detection of trends or changes that may require medical attention. This can be especially beneficial for managing chronic conditions or monitoring recovery from injuries or surgeries.
